      Hi All,
      So after figuring out everything else I am still stuck on getting FogService to change the resolution of my display from 800x640 to 1600x900. I have DisplayManager installed on both my image and enabled in the global config, as well as the individual host config however the resolution just isn’t being changed.

      Fog successfully renames the computers and joins the domain. c:\fog.log doesn’t seem to contain anything helpful at all (literally just contains where the update checker checks for updates)

      What can I do to help solve this problem, and what additional information do you require in order to understand my issue.

        I believe the display resolution is a global setting in FOG 0.32. You have to have it turned on at the client config, the global config in the FOG web UI, and you set the resolution in the global settings also. I don’t think the settings for each client currently work, but I could be wrong.

        I do not use the display manager in my FOG setup, but I have read of others having issue getting it to work except on a all hosts.
